加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0570zz.com/)- 应用程序、数据可视化、建站、人脸识别、低代码!
当前位置: 首页 > 教程 > 正文

ASP进阶实战:站长安全与效率跃升指南

发布时间:2026-04-25 09:56:41 所属栏目:教程 来源:DaWei
导读:  ASP(Active Server Pages)作为早期的动态网页技术,虽然在现代开发中逐渐被ASP.NET等更先进的框架取代,但许多站长仍在使用或维护基于ASP的网站。因此,掌握ASP进阶技巧,不仅能提升网站的安全性,还能显著提高

  ASP(Active Server Pages)作为早期的动态网页技术,虽然在现代开发中逐渐被ASP.NET等更先进的框架取代,但许多站长仍在使用或维护基于ASP的网站。因此,掌握ASP进阶技巧,不仅能提升网站的安全性,还能显著提高运维效率。


  在安全方面,ASP网站最容易受到注入攻击、跨站脚本(XSS)和文件包含漏洞的影响。为了防止SQL注入,应避免直接拼接用户输入到SQL语句中,而是使用参数化查询或存储过程。同时,对用户输入进行严格的过滤和验证,可以有效降低风险。


  文件包含漏洞是ASP网站常见的安全隐患之一。建议避免使用动态文件路径,尤其是通过用户输入来决定包含的文件。如果必须使用,应严格限制可包含的文件范围,并确保路径不会被篡改。


  在提升效率方面,合理利用缓存机制可以大幅减少服务器负载。例如,使用Response.Cache对象对静态内容进行缓存,能够加快页面加载速度。同时,定期清理无用的日志文件和临时文件,有助于保持服务器运行流畅。


AI预测模型,仅供参考

  代码优化也是提升性能的关键。避免重复的数据库连接和查询,合理使用Session和Application对象,能有效减少资源消耗。将常用函数封装成独立的ASP文件,便于复用和维护。


  对于站长而言,定期更新和维护ASP网站至关重要。关注官方补丁和安全公告,及时修复已知漏洞,可以有效防止潜在威胁。同时,建立完善的备份机制,确保在发生意外时能快速恢复数据。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章